Multi Color Ladder Bracelet
This is a new bead stitch for me. The ladder stitch is relatively easy and adding the
additional beads was fun to do. Watching the bracelet develop into something sparkly and pretty is always satisfying! The base colors are soft pastels, then I added the silver as what I'll call the fringe. At first, I thought the silver overpowered the pastels too much and I think I still feel that way just a bit. But, all in all I'm pretty happy with the way it turned out.

Purple Violet Necklace
I created the neck cord using green AB and gold glass seed beads applying the spiral round bead stitch. The pendent is a hand painted button. The necklace is approximately 20-inches in length and ends with a gold plated lobster clasp.

Black and Gold Butterfly Necklace
I created this with black and gold glass seedbeads using the spiral round bead stitch.
The pendent is a hand painted wooden button. The necklace is approximately 20-inches
in length and ends with a gold plated lobster clasp.

Dogwood Flower Necklace
I finished this necklace earlier in the week and I think it came out beautiful.
A yellow and white seed beaded spiral adorned with a handpainted dogwood flower button. I thought it made the cutest pendent. The necklace is almost 20 inches in length and it connects with a goldplated lobster clasp. I used Nymo thread to bead with, it's so nice to work with.
I tried the necklace on and it's so light I practically didn't know I had anything around my neck. I'm working on another using a wooden butterfly button. I found the buttons at JoAnne Fabrics and I think incorporating them with the beaded spiral looks great.
I finished up some earrings I had too. They're pretty and perfect for summer wear.
